Abstract: In this paper a theoretical consideration of quasi-steady- state generation of dye lasers (DL) with an isotropic Fabry- Perot-type resonator and coaxial (longitudinal) laser pumping is presented for the regime of saturation in the orientation distribution of excited molecules. Our analysis is carried out for cases of parallel and orthogonal mutual orientation of dipole moments of transitions with absorption and emission in dye molecules. The effect of intensity and polarization state of longitudinal pumping on the degree of linear polarization and output intensity of DL has been clarified. A preference of circular pump polarization occurs in our theory. The comparison of the results obtained with the experimental studies is also performed.!20
